Emphasizing the power of reflection and mindfulness from "summary" of The Yes Brain by Daniel J. Siegel,Tina Payne Bryson

Emphasizing the power of reflection and mindfulness is a key component of nurturing a Yes Brain in both children and adults. This concept involves fostering an awareness of one's thoughts, feelings, and actions in order to cultivate a sense of understanding and control over one's inner world. By encouraging individuals to take the time to reflect on their experiences and emotions, they can develop a greater capacity for self-regulation and emotional resilience. Mindfulness practices, such as meditation and deep breathing exercises, can help individuals become more attuned to their inner states and better able to respond to challenging situations with calmness and clarity. By cultivating a sense of presence and awareness in the present moment, individuals can learn to observe their thoughts and emotions without judgment, allowing them to respond thoughtfully rather than react impulsively. Reflection involves taking the time to contemplate past experiences and consider how they have influenced one's thoughts, beliefs, and behaviors. By engaging in reflective practices, individuals can gain valuable insights into their own patterns and tendencies, enabling them to make more conscious choices in the future. This process of self-examination can lead to greater self-awareness and personal growth, as individuals become more attuned to their own values, goals, and aspirations. In a world that is often fast-paced and demanding, the practice of reflection and mindfulness can provide a valuable counterbalance, helping individuals to slow down, tune in, and connect with their own inner wisdom. By making space for contemplation and self-reflection, individuals can develop a deeper sense of self-understanding and cultivate a Yes Brain that is open, flexible, and resilient in the face of life's challenges.
